Animal Charity to dedicate benches

BOARDMAN

Animal Charity Humane Society will dedicate its new “Bench of Giving and Paw Steps of Love” at 12:30 p.m. Sunday.

The Bench of Giving is two concrete benches that have the names of sponsors, including local businesses, engraved on them to show their support for the organization. The Paw Steps are similar and have the names of people in businesses that have donated to Animal Charity to show it takes many people to stop animal cruelty, according to a news release.

Animal Charity is a nonprofit humane agency at 4140 Market St.

Man gets 3 years for drug conspiracy

CLEVELAND

Daniel Infante, 23, of Campbell, has been sentenced to three years’ probation for his role in a drug conspiracy. U.S. District Court Judge Dan Aaron Polster imposed the sentence Thursday upon Infante, who earlier had pleaded guilty to conspiracy to distribute cocaine and heroin. Infante was one of 25 Youngstown-area residents indicted by a federal grand jury in the case in June 2011. The drug sales occurred on Youngstown’s East Side and in Campbell, authorities said.

Section of road will close Monday

Canfield

Another section of Western Reserve Road will close Monday as the county continues its reconstruction project.

The road will close for 45 days between state Route 46 and Covington Cove as part of Phase 4 of the project.

Traffic will be detoured along U.S. Route 62, Leffingwell Road and state Route 46. Local traffic will be permitted to drive the road.
